OpenCore Sammelthread (Hilfe und Diskussion)
- derHackfan
- Unerledigt
-
-
-
hat jemand mit 060 einen Schub bei der Bootzeit erlebt ?
Bei mir ist was Komisches passiert :
Wechsel von 057 auf 060 , keine wirkliche Verbesserung paar Neustarts später ging aber mein Sound nicht mehr (konnte OC ausschließen)
Platte gekillt und ein Backup per Stick (Time Machine) vom 1. Juni direkt drauf gebraten, direkt mit OC 060 gebootet und siehe da anstatt 23-25 sec Bootzeit auf einmal bei 10-11 sec.
Ich hab KEINE Ahnung wie das passieren könnte
kann auch nicht sagen ob es nun OC060 ist oder was anderes , mein Install kanns eigentlich nicht sein da es ja Komplett Backup der Platte ist...
(Bootzeit meine ich von Apfel bis Login Screen , also nicht Bios !)
-
NVRAM geleert und TRIM deaktiviert?
-
NVram geleert hatte ich ja .
Trimm müsste ich nun nochmal schauen ich hab zwar NVME als Bootdrive aber für Daten ne SATA SSD , war sonst früher an.
check ich daheim gleich mal !
-
Dann weißt du jetzt warum er schneller startet. Beim Leeren vom NVRAM wird auch TRIM deaktiviert, außer man hat es per Kext Patch aktiviert. Seit Catalina speichert Apple den TRIM Status im NVRAM. Total bescheuert...
Aber mit OpenCore kannst du ja NVRAM Variablen vorgeben und das Ding somit als "default" setzen. Dann hast du das Problem künftig nicht mehr wenn du den NVRAM leerst.
-
Hallo zusammen,
ich wollte mit meinen Hackintosh (iMac14,2 aus Signatur) mal auf OpenCore umsteigen. Soweit so gut jetzt bin ich an einem Punkt wo ich irgendwie nicht alleine weiter komme. Ich hänge im Moment an folgender Stelle fest -> siehe Screenshot
hat eventuell jemand ne Idee woran das liegen kann.Gruß Mocca55
-
Du solltest dein ACPI Patching neu implementieren. Probiers erstmal indem du alle ACPI Patches von Clover Zeiten entfernst und dann nur schrittweise das nötigste wieder hinzufügst.
-
trimm ist aber bei mir in der Config aktiv, sollte es dann nicht automatisch gesetzt werden ?
Und ich hab schon früher unter Catalina NVRAM resetts gemacht und nie diesen schub danach gehabt, aber könnte sein das ich beim wechsel auf 060 Trim in der config nicht aktiv geschalten habe ( was aber nicht erklärt wieso VOR einspielen des Backups er nochmal langsam bootete, da ich bei jedem OC Wechsel einmal NVram clear mache immer)
-
War ja nur ein Ansatz. Einzelheiten deiner Config kenne ich nicht. Erfahrungen mit Kext Patches zum TRIM enablen habe ich auch nicht, Ich mache das ausschließlich mit den Bordmitteln da ich nicht drauf stehe an unnötigen Stellen im System zu pfuschen. Vielleicht kommt der Boost auch von woanders, wirst du ja dann herausfinden.
-
-
Yes, vorallem mit den ACPI Renames mit denen vielen Clover User nur so um sich schmeißen muss man aufpassen Einiges wird von Lilu Plugins wie WEG auf IO Ebene übernommen, das ist wesentlich sicherer und ausreichend.
-
So bin nun nochmal meine Config durch.
hab NICHTS verändert.
Trim ist an und auch nach erneutem NVRAM bleibt der Bootspeed
so manchmal sind so zufälle doch echt strange ABER egal Feier ich einfach
-
-
Servus,
ich hatte OC 0.5.9 und Catalina 10.5.5 am laufen, doch seit heute wird OC beim Booten übergangen. Im UEFI wird es als Boot Eintrag angezeigt, aber selbst an erster Stelle, startet gleich Windows. MacOS und Windows sind auf zwei verschiedenen SSDs. Habt ihr Ideen woran das liegen könnte ?
-
Guckux rinlau7
schau mal in den EFI Ordner Deiner ESP - vielleicht hat M$ da rumgepfuscht...?
-
rinlau7 Genau, schau mal nach, ob ein Microsoft-Ordner in deinem EFI-Ordner liegt. Wenn ja, ist das kein Grund zur Panik, den könnte man, falls vorhanden, in der OpenCore-config.plist unter Misc -> BlessOverride einfach wie folgt eintragen:
und ggf. noch unter PlatformInfo -> Generic "AdviseWindows" aktivieren.
Ansonsten (bzw. so oder so) mal den Windows-Eintrag im UEFI/BIOS komplett aus den Startoptionen entfernen und nur zum Testen in der config.plist mal "ShowPicker" unter Misc -> Boot aktivieren, um sicherzustellen, dass nicht Windows einfach gerade versehentlich dein Standard-Boot-Volume in OpenCore ist und vielleicht eben doch von OpenCore gestartet wird. In dem Fall müsstest du macOS nur einmal mit Ctrl-Enter vom OpenCore-Menü aus booten, dann wäre das wieder der Standard (oder halt in den macOS-Systemeinstellungen unter "Startvolume" auswählen).
Falls es dir gar nicht erst möglich ist, macOS zu booten, so dass du die config.plist bequem bearbeiten kannst, kannst du auch mal versuchen, den Rechner mit gedrückter X-Taste zu starten (Taste halten, bis hoffentlich der Apfel erscheint – bei ner Bluetooth-Tastatur wird es etwas schwieriger, da müsstest du ggf. immer 1–2 Sekunden drücken, dann wieder loslassen, dann wieder drücken, muss aber nicht so sein). Das funktioniert aber auch nur dann, wenn OpenCore eben doch geladen wird, ansonsten nicht.
-
Liebe Community
Wende mich nach vielen Stunden vergeblicher Mühe hoffnungsvoll an Euch, da ich aktuell mit meinem Opencore 0.5.9 Setup nicht mehr weiterkomme. Bin gerade dabei meinen aktuellen Clover Bootloader auf die aktuelle Opencore Version zu wechseln.
Habe mir zu diesem Zweck im Internet eine EFI Konfiguration eines nahezu identischen Acer V5-572g Laptops mit i5 Prozessor besorgt (mein Prozessor ist ein i3).
Habe in meiner Config.plist unter ACPI zwei generische SSDTs (SSDT-EC-Laptop und SSDT-PNLF) gemäss Anleitung eingebunden. Komme damit bis zum Desktop. Allerdings friert der Rechner nach ca. 1 Minute ein. Schätze es kommt im Hintergrund zu einer Kernel Panic im Zusammenhang mit dem AppleIntelCPUPowerManagement (Ivy Bridge wird hier nicht allzu gut unterstützt). Habe dann gemäss Post-Install Anleitung mit dem entsprechenden ssdtPRGen.sh-Beta Script eine zusätzliche SSDT-PM erstellt, diese führte aber zu einer Kernel Panic noch während des Boot Vorgangs. Die empfohlenen ACPI Delete Positionen (Drop CpuPm und Drop Cpu0Ist) bekomme ich nicht zum Laufen. Werden nicht ausgeführt. Habe sie dann wieder deaktiviert.
Opencore bootet von einem USB Stick wirklich sehr schnell (ein gewähltes Setup um meine Clover Installation auf meiner internen SDD während der Testphase zu schützen). Viel fehlt hier hoffentlich nicht mehr.
Habe meine Config.plist mit dem Ivy Bridge / Opencore 0.5.9 Sanity Checker geprüft - keine Fehlermeldungen.
Habe weiters einen VBoxHFS.efi Treiber zwischenzeitlich gegen den empfohlenen HfsPlus.efi Treiber ausgetauscht, konnte dann aber den Opencore Picker nicht mehr erreichen und habe wieder zurück gewechselt.
In Zusammenhang mit der Verwendung von Opencore stellt sich auch die Frage, wie ich meinen NVRAM schützen kann. Opencore schreibt den NVRAM mit allerlei Boot Argumenten und Variablen voll, die - solange Opencore noch nicht fehlerfrei läuft - ständig zu Problemen bei meinen Clover Boots führen. Habe dann den NVRAM zurückgesetzt und mir damit jede Menge Probleme mit gelöschten UEFI Boot Einträgen eingehandelt. Musste diese nun mühsam mit EasyUefi über Windows wieder reparieren. Kann dies eventuell mit dem Config.plist Eintrag WriteFlash=No (NVRAM Sektion) unterbunden werden? Möchte meinen NVRAM nicht noch einmal zurücksetzen und reparieren müssen.
Hänge meine EFI als Zip zur Durchsicht an. Dazu auch noch mein Opencore Bootlog. Mein RAM ist 4GB und meine SMBIOS Kennung: MacBookAir5,2.
Wäre schön, wenn mir jemand weiterhelfen könnte. Habe die nächsten Tage nur sporadisch Zugriff auf meinen Rechner und kann daher nicht zeitnah antworten. Bitte um Nachsicht.
Herzlichen Dank für Eure Mühe.
Liebe Grüsse
Max
-
In deinem angehängten EFI Ordner befinden sich weder in der Config.plist Einträge zu ACPI, noch befinden sich im ACPI Ordner besagte Dateien.
-
Vielen Dank für das Durchsehen. Habe die SSDTs rausgenommen, da es mit oder ohne beim Hochfahren keinen Unterschied macht. Komme bis zum Desktop. Habe bei Griffen (glaube mich erinnern zu können) gelesen, dass man anfänglich auf SSDTs verzichten kann.
Alles funktioniert nach dem Hochfahren (bis eventuell auf Sleep - kann ich aufgrund der Kürze der Zeit bis zum Freeze nicht checken) , sogar Wifi (habe die ursprüngliche Karte vor langer Zeit gegen eine Hackintosh kompatible Atheros ausgetauscht). Dann hängt sich der Rechner auf. USB Stick zum Booten ist noch eingesteckt. USB Dongle für die Funkmaus auch - Ports funktionieren.
Vielen Dank.
Max
Danke ternes3
Hatte tatsächlich etwas mit den SSDT-ECs zu tun. Nach Studium folgender Web Seite:
https://medium.com/macoclock/c…n-hackintosh-85d76ad89d24
konnte ich mit Hackintool eine funktionierende SSDT-EC-USBX.aml erstellen. Die vom SSDT Generator "ssdtPRGen.sh-Beta" erstellte SSDT-EC.aml hat bei mir nicht funktioniert.
Die Web Seite erklärt den Sachverhalt rund um das Thema AppleACPIEC.kext einfach und verständlich.
Thema gelöst. Läuft jetzt ohne Kernel Panics. Danke.
Max